Tommy Thomson

Candidate for Village Clerk

Village of Franklin Park

Tommy Thomson has served as the Franklin Park Village Clerk since 2009. He has increased the efficiencies in the Clerk’s Office and made the office more responsive to our citizens. He has worked closely with Mayor Pedersen to increase the transparency and accountability of Village government.

Under Tommy’s leadership the Clerk’s Office has become a model of productivity and efficiency. He has streamlined operations and reduced bureaucracy by making more information available on-line. He has instilled a customer friendly atmosphere that treats all our citizens respectfully.

Tommy continues to seek ways to make even more information and processes available online, including information on purchasing and contracts.

Tommy served as a combat medic in the United States Army and followed in his father’s footsteps to become a firefighter. He has been with the Franklin Park Fire Department for 14 years and is also a certified paramedic. In this capacity, he has consistently demonstrated a strong commitment to his job and to serving the community. Last year, while driving down Rose Street, he noticed smoke coming from a building. He forced entry into the building and rescued a civilian from the burning apartment. For his heroic efforts, Tommy received the Medal of Valor Award by the Office of the Illinois State Fire Marshall for serving as an example of someone who puts his life in danger to protect and save the lives of others. He enjoys helping and serving the residents and businesses of Franklin Park and always has the safety of our families and our neighborhoods as one of his highest priorities.

Tommy served as Trustee on the Franklin Park Library Board from 2001-2007 and was Treasurer for two years. He is an active member of the American Legion Post 974 and donates his time to the St. Baldrick’s Foundation to help raise funds to develop a cure for childhood cancers.

Tommy is a lifelong resident of Franklin Park, attended District 83 schools and is a graduate of East Leyden High School. He attended Triton College and received a B.S. in Management from the University of Phoenix.
